It is exposed that BAIC's acquisition of Daimler shares will surpass Geely to become the largest shareholder.

AutoBeta(AutoBeta.net)12/16 Report--

In July 2019, BAIC officially announced that it had completed the acquisition of 5% of Daimler's shares, making it the third largest shareholder in Daimler, second only to major shareholder Geely Group 9.7% and Kuwait sovereign fund 6.8%. BAIC has launched a plan to increase its stake in Daimler to about 10%, surpassing Geely's stake, Reuters reported today.

640.webp.jpg

BAIC, a Daimler joint venture partner, has launched a plan to double its stake in Daimler to about 10 per cent, winning a seat on the board of directors of the German luxury carmaker to replace rival Geely as Daimler's largest single shareholder, Reuters reported, citing sources.

BAIC has begun to buy shares in Daimler on the open market, and HSBC is helping BAIC to make new investments, the report said. In response to the news, Tang Shikai, chief executive of Daimler China, said, "We welcome long-term investors."

Some analysts believe that BAIC strongly surpasses Geely's shareholding to lock it into Daimler's most senior partner in the Chinese market.

According to sources, once BAIC completes the acquisition, about 10% of the shares will surpass Geely to become Daimler's largest shareholder, while Geely will be the second shareholder. As a result, Daimler has also become a German luxury carmaker with Chinese capital power.

After Geely became a major shareholder in Daimler, in March 2019, the two sides announced a joint venture in China, each with a 50% stake, to jointly operate and promote the transformation of the Smart brand around the world, turning smart into an electric smart car brand, which will be produced in a new factory in China and is expected to be put on the market and sold globally in 2022.

In July this year, BAIC successfully bought a stake in Daimler and held a 5% stake in Daimler. At that time, Xu Heyi, chairman of BAIC, said: "BAIC and Daimler adhere to the principles of mutual trust and reciprocity and have a history of cooperation for more than 10 years. Outstanding performance. It has always been BAIC's wish to deepen the partnership through investment in Daimler. Investing in Daimler will enhance the synergy and support of our management and corporate strategy with Daimler. The partnership between BAIC and Daimler is an excellent example of Sino-German cooperation, as well as a model of cooperation between companies of the two countries. We look forward to working with Daimler to continue the success of our long-standing cooperation. "

BAIC and Daimler have a cooperative relationship for more than a decade, and the two sides also have a cross-shareholding model. Since 2005, BAIC and Daimler have established a joint venture "Beijing Mercedes-Benz", in which BAIC has a 51% stake in the joint venture. In 2012, BAIC Foton, which is controlled by BAIC, formed a joint venture with Daimler to produce medium and heavy trucks. In March 2016, BAIC acquired 35% of Fujian Mercedes-Benz, completing the "unification" of the Mercedes-Benz brand in China. In 2013, Daimler bought Beijing Automobile, a Hong Kong-listed company owned by BAIC, and has since become a member of Beijing Automobile's board of directors, with a current stake of 9.55%. In 2018, Beijing Mercedes-Benz acquired a BAIC factory in Shunyi, Beijing. In addition, Daimler has a 3.01% stake in BAIC New Energy.

Daimler AG (Daimler AG), headquartered in Stuttgart, Germany, is the world's largest commercial vehicle manufacturer, the world's largest luxury car manufacturer and the second largest truck manufacturer. The company includes four major business units: Mercedes-Benz, Mercedes-Benz light commercial vehicles, Daimler trucks and Daimler Financial Services.

According to the third-quarter results report of Beijing Automobile in 2019, the total revenue in the first three quarters was 138.03 billion yuan, an increase of 14.8% over the same period last year. The net profit attributed to the owner of the parent company was 3.004 billion yuan, down 21.1% from the same period last year. Among them, Beijing Mercedes-Benz sold 425400 vehicles in the first three quarters, an increase of 17.4% over the same period last year. It is worth noting that Beijing Mercedes-Benz contributed nearly 90% of its revenue to Beijing Automobile in 2018 and the first half of 2019, which can be called the performance cow of Beijing Automobile.
